研究概览

简要总结

The purpose of this study is to determine whether 5 - methyltetrahydrofolate and vitamin B12 supplementation can ameliorate cell plasma membrane features in pediatric patients with cystic fibrosis

详细描述

Cystic fibrosis (CF) is one of the most common fatal autosomal recessive disorders in the Caucasian population caused by mutations of gene for the cystic fibrosis transmembrane conductance regulator (CFTR). New experimental therapeutic strategies for CF propose a diet supplementation to affect the plasma membrane fluidity and to modulate the cellular amplified inflammatory response in CF target organs. Red blood cells (RBCs) were used to investigate plasma membrane, because RBCs share lipid, protein composition and organization with other cell types.
